commit c104c16073b7fdb3e4eae18f66f4009f6b073d6f upstream. The longest length of a symbol (KSYM_NAME_LEN) was increased to 512 in the reference [1]. This patch adds kunit test suite to check the longest symbol length. These tests verify that the longest symbol length defined is supported. This test can also help other efforts for longer symbol length, like [2]. The test suite defines one symbol with the longest possible length. The first test verify that functions with names of the created symbol, can be called or not. The second test, verify that the symbols are created (or not) in the kernel symbol table.
